RE: disabling the voiceover caption window

2015-10-16 Thread M. Taylor
Hello Michael, To hide the VoiceOver caption panel: 1. >From the VoiceOver Utility dialog box, select Visuals in the category table. 2. Select the VoiceOver Caption Panel tab. 3. Uncheck the Show Caption Panel checkbox. Mark From: macvisionaries@googlegroups.com [mailto:macvisionaries@google

safely removing hardware

2015-10-16 Thread Marie Lyons
How do you do this on a Mac? -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"MacVisionaries" group. To unsubscribe from this group and stop receiving emails from it, send an email to macvisionaries+unsubscr...@googlegroups.com. To post to this group, send email to

Re: safely removing hardware

2015-10-16 Thread Alex Hall
The easiest way I know is to eject it. It will be on your desktop, unless you've changed that setting, or in your computer folder. So, either press vo-shift-d or cmd-shift-c, find the drive, and press cmd-e to eject it. Once it disappears from the list, it's okay to remove it. I wish the Mac wou
